In the next few days the leader of the BNP, Nick Griffin, is appearing on Question Time. The Union of Jewish Students is committed to combating fascism and racism, and want you - yes YOU - to join us in this most important of endeavours.

To show your support for a diverse, open Britain, and your opposition to fascists and racists, please sign up to the Twitter Protest.

What do you need to do to join the Twitter Protest?

Joining Twitter is very simple. A standard sign up process is well signposted when you join via twitter.com. From there, you can choose to follow other users and post your own comments. Under the 'find people' button, search for BNPPROTWEST - Once you have found us we ask that you copy our opening message:

Join the BNP-Protwest expose the BNP's poor policy, lies and mis-deeds.
Take action at
http://www.hopenothate.org.uk/ say #NOTOBNP

A 'hashtag (#)' as above, is a signpost for a subject. You will see if you use the hash, that you can click on the words that follow it.

Doing so will take you through to a list of all of the 'tweets' (messages) about this campaign.
